Prototype of Fault Identification in the Electric Power Distribution Network with Remote Signalling

Abstract

This article describes the construction of a prototype using the Arduino platform, in conjunction with Fault Identifier Equipment (FI), in order to facilitate the identification of faulty stretches in the electric power distribution networks, thus optimizing the entire displacement process of the teams in the field in the execution of maneuvers to isolate the defects, which provide a reduction in the indicators of the company be they external or internal and a consumer satisfaction that in turn will have its energy reestablishes in a shorter time.
